In 2008 Hidalgo missed GN Semi-Finals by 2 class places (They placed 4th out of I think 13 in their prelims block.....they needed to have placed 2nd to advance in 1A). Adair County (KY) dominates class 1A though in the same way Marian Catholic dominates 2A. If Adair were to be scheduled on a different day than Argyle, they could probably pull it off and advance. Whitesboro is in a similar position this year. Adair County is an interesting place to produce such a high quality band. The school's rural town of Columbia, KY is one of the poorest towns in America. They have a median per capita income of $15,632/yr, which is basically minimum wage. This is the polar opposite of Argyle, which is a tiny master planned enclave of 3,000 people where your typical family makes six figures. Quote
